Adjective

IPA: /ˈskɪlfəl/ Audio: en-us-skilful.ogg [US] Forms: more skilful [comparative], most skilful [superlative]
Rhymes: -ɪlfəl Head templates: {{en-adj}} skilful (comparative more skilful, superlative most skilful)
  1. Non-US (including but not limited to Australian, British, Canadian, Irish, Jamaican, South African and New Zealand) standard spelling of skillful. Derived forms: skilfully
